ORA-55343: invalid dependent component for custom label generator

文档解释

ORA-55343: invalid dependent component for custom label generator

Cause: An attempt was made to specify an invalid dependent component for the label generator.

Action: Correct the input and try again.

ORA-55343: invalid dependent component for custom label generator

错误说明:

ORA-55343是Oracle数据库出现错误时显示的信息,意思是定制的标签生成器存在有无效的依赖组件。它是Oracle数据库中报出的并发控制错误,声明跟踪库中的一个无效的依赖组件。它通常发生在多用户环境中,比如在客户端有两个或更多的会话尝试访问同一个表的时候。

常见案例

ORA-55343错误通常会发生在下列情况:

-在客户端会话中相同表的执行查询时

-更新表时,另一个会话正在读取它

-试图删除一个表,但在另一个客户端会话查询表中的数据

解决方法:

ORA-55343错误的最佳解决方法是针对特定的情况来写出正确的SQL查询或其他操作,以避免多用户并发访问冲突。一些关于解决这个错误的如下方法:

-在查询之前使用SELECT FOR UPDATE

-由一个会话的操作完成后,再由另一个会话操作

-确保所有更新操作要么都成功要么都失败

-使用SQL克隆创建备份表

-使用外部表锁定正在被使用的表

-使用连接池封锁来管理多用户访问

你可能感兴趣的